Millie David Set for England Rugby Debut

Millie David Set for England Rugby Debut

In an exciting development for English rugby, Millie David, a talented winger from the Bristol Bears, is poised to earn her first international cap this Saturday against Wales in the Women's Six Nations. This match marks a significant moment for the 20-year-old, who has been recognized for her outstanding performances in the Premier 15s league, where she finished as one of the top try-scorers last season.

David's selection comes as England looks to solidify their back-three combination following the retirement of World Cup winner Abby Dow. Her impressive form has not gone unnoticed, and she has been a standout player despite her club's struggles this season. Alongside David, Claudia Moloney-MacDonald will occupy the other wing, while Ellie Kildunne, who previously scored two tries against Scotland, returns to her usual role as full-back.

The match against Wales will take place at Ashton Gate in Bristol, and fans can catch the action live on BBC Two and the BBC Sport website. England's squad has faced challenges with injuries, leading to a near fourth-choice second-row combination. Lilli Ives Campion's knee injury has sidelined her, while several players, including Zoe Stratford, Abbie Ward, and Rosie Galligan, are currently unavailable due to pregnancy.

In the engine room, Abi Burton and Delaney Burns will partner up, with Burns returning to the squad after a long absence. The fly-half position sees Holly Aitchison stepping in for Zoe Harrison, indicating a strategic shift as England aims to maintain their competitive edge.

Despite the disruptions, England's depth and talent are expected to be sufficient to overcome a Welsh side that has struggled in recent Six Nations tournaments, finishing at the bottom of the table in the last two editions.
